- The distance between Pago Pago, Tutuila, American Samoa and Abu Dhabi/ Bateen Ap, United Arab Emirates is approximately 15,167 km or 9,425 mi.
- To reach Pago Pago, Tutuila in this distance one would set out from Abu Dhabi/ Bateen Ap bearing 85.3°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Pago Pago, Tutuila bearing 110.5° or ESE .
- Pago Pago, Tutuila has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Abu Dhabi/ Bateen Ap has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- The average temperature is 0.3 °C (0.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.2 °C (23.8°F) less in Pago Pago, Tutuila.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 3198.9 mm (125.9 in) more which is equivalent to 3198.9 l/m² (78.51 US gal/ft²) or 31,989,000 l/ha (3,419,836 US gal/ac) more. About 57 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.7° higher in Pago Pago, Tutuila than in Abu Dhabi/ Bateen Ap.
- Relative humidity levels are 20.8%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 4.4°C (8°F) higher.
